Humans need protein in their diet on a daily basis because it helps the body develop and mend. Yet, since humans are unable to produce proteins on their own, they must obtain their needs from plants and animals. Milk, eggs, fish, meat, and gelatin are some examples of sources of animal proteins. Peas, soy, rice, wheat, and canola are examples of sources of plant proteins. Among them, soy protein and milk protein products have shown tremendous growth in popularity among vegetarians and vegans, respectively.
The increased consumer preference for protein-rich foods, which has led to increased demand for soy and milk protein components, is one of the most recent trends in the food industry. This shift can be attributed to rising disposable incomes, a rise in lifestyle diseases, and increased consumer knowledge of health and wellbeing.
As sources for soy protein are also abundant in iron, fibre, calcium, potassium, magnesium, vitamin B, lecithin, and polyunsaturated fats, they are quickly replacing meat and eggs in the manufacture of a variety of food products, which is reinforcing the need for these ingredients.
